Material Notes:
CLTE is a ceramic powder-filled and woven micro fiberglass reinforced PTFE composite engineered to produce a stable, low water absorption laminate with a nominal Dielectric Constant of 2.98.Ceramic/PTFE compositeLow water absorptionHigh thermal conductivityLow lossTight Dk and Thickness toleranceBenefits:Thermally stable Dk and DfDimensional stabilityTypical Applications:Radar ManifoldsPhased Array AntennasMicrowave Feed NetworksPhase Sensitive Electric StructuresPAs, LNAs, LNBsSatellite & Space ElectronicsThis data represents typical values for the production material and should not be used as material specifications.Information provided by ARLON Silicone Technologies Division.
